Loreena McKennitt’s Greek concerts rescheduled to close Mediterranean tourLoreena McKennitt’s three concerts in Greece have been rescheduled, the singer announced today. The tour, which was to have begun in Fez Morocco, will now open in Turkey, with a major concert in Istanbul on Saturday June 13 — and the Greek concerts will come at the end of the tour.
The rescheduled Greek dates are now June 27 at the Ancient Odeum at Patra, June 28 at Moni Lazariston in Thessaloniki, and June 29 at Theatro Vrachon in Athens.
Concertgoers do not need to exchange their tickets; tickets for the original dates will be honoured. Tickets are still available for the three concerts, and will return for sale on Tuesday, June 9.
Ms. McKennitt’s long awaited Mediterranean tour has been complicated by the illness of her mother, which caused the cancellation of a performance at the Festival of World Sacred Music in Fez Morocco.
“I am relieved that my mother’s health issues are stabilized, and look forward to embarking on this tour. I so look forward to meeting audiences in Turkey, Cyprus, Lebanon, Hungary, Sicily and Greece,” she stated.
As a result of the Fez cancellation and original Greek postponements, regrettably, Loreena’s appearance in Tel Aviv on June 18th will be rescheduled at the request of the local promoter.
